Don’t Starve Together Hits 120K Peak for 10th Anniversary: 90% Off Sale & Free Friend Code

Don’t Starve Together, the cooperative survival title from Klei Entertainment, reached a record-breaking 122,662 concurrent players on Steam this past weekend, according to SteamDB. This surge surpasses the previous April 2023 peak of 115,925 players, marking the highest engagement in the game’s ten-year history and signaling a significant shift from its typical 50,000 to 70,000 player range.

Why is Don’t Starve Together seeing record player numbers now?

The record-breaking traffic is driven by a combination of a major content expansion and an aggressive promotional discount. On June 12, Klei Entertainment released From Beyond – Curse of the Moon, the first chapter of a new story arc. This update introduced the Sanctum area, a new boss, and specialized loot drops, alongside quality-of-life improvements such as a navigation tool for the Sanctum. According to Steam, the game is also currently available at a 90% discount until June 26, bringing the price to approximately NT$26—a move that includes an extra copy of the game for users to gift to friends.

What new features arrived with the Curse of the Moon update?

The latest expansion focuses on survival mechanics and exploration within the Sanctum. Players can now utilize ropes to traverse the environment and return to the surface from the Ancient Archives, as reported by the official developer patch notes. New items include thermal-based tools, coal traps, and a healing “Fire-Suppressing Salve.” Additionally, the update refined existing mechanics: ancient keys no longer break upon use, and the item collection interface now allows for easier dismantling of duplicate treasures.

How does the developer balance new updates with future projects?

Despite the announcement of a new series entry, Don’t Starve Elsewhere, in April, Klei Entertainment maintains that development on Don’t Starve Together will continue. The team is already working on the second chapter of the Curse of the Moon story. By providing consistent updates alongside 20th-anniversary celebration events—such as the “Thank You for 20 Years Together” login bonus—the studio aims to keep the player base active while transitioning into new titles.
